Property Description for 59 Bank Street, 4

Perfectly located in the heart of the historic West Village, on one of the most enchanting, coveted landmark blocks in New York City, Residence 4 at 59 Bank Street is a rare gem. This gorgeous full-floor 2 bedroom 2.5 bathroom loft epitomizes the allure of downtown living, brimming with elegant details and brightened by oversized windows on 4 exposures.


The light-bathed apartment has been impeccably renovated for modern tastes yet retains the charm of the building’s character. High pressed-tin ceiling ceilings, beautiful original hardwood floors, walls of warm exposed brick, tall pocket doors, and chic industrial elements throughout make this a true loft lover’s dream.


Enter via key-locked elevator into expansive open interiors built for entertaining. A fabulous layout stretching approx. 68’ affords a seamless flow and accommodates numerous seating and dining arrangements for hosting large or intimate gatherings. The abundance of space throughout offers plenty of room for a home office setup, either in the generous main living space or the 2nd bedroom. Enjoy lots of sunshine and lovely views to the East, and south over Bank Street with a glimpse down to One World Trade tower. The recently renovated, open windowed kitchen is designed for the cook and tastefully appointed with premium countertops, a breakfast bar, and premium stainless steel appliances by Viking, Sub-Zero and Miele.


Pocket doors lead to the quiet, graciously proportioned primary bedroom with 4 sunny northern windows and room for a sitting area. A huge walk-in closet and poured concrete en-suite windowed bath with a relaxing soaking tub plus spa shower enhance the luxury experience. Additional highlights include a 2nd bedroom with en-suite bath, convenient powder room by the entry, a Miele washer and dryer, and central forced air heat/A/C for year-round comfort.


59 Bank Street is an intimate 6-unit condominium in the prime West Village, with the added bonus of a common roof deck for residents where you can lounge, socialize, and gaze at great views of the Empire State Building and downtown skyline. Situated near the corner of West 4th and Bank Streets, the building has a prime address near a plethora of shops, restaurants, parks, subways and other amenities.

West Village | Manhattan

Quick Profile

Known for its high-end shopping on Bleecker Street, the elegant brownstones dating back to colonial times that have been depicted in films and television, the abundance of cafes, and its celebrity residents, the West Village neighborhood is what springs to mind when you think of the essence of New York City. This is a neighborhood where the pace of life is less hurried, and harried, than in other neighborhoods, exuding an understated elegance and naturally beautiful sophistication and charm. 

The West Village has something to offer everyone, whether your taste runs to designer goods and trend-setting restaurants, or you are happier browsing thrift stores and whiling away the hours in conversation with friends at a hole-in-the-wall coffee shop. There are public green spaces dotted throughout this neighborhood, where you can stop and commune with nature, or grab a bite to eat from a local deli or cafe and have a picnic. The Hudson River Park offers recreational opportunities and events for all ages.

There is a tradition of bohemian non-conformity attached to the West Village. Even the intimate, tree-lined, and sometimes cobblestoned, streets refuse to conform to the grid layout of the rest of Manhattan. Activism and social consciousness have always been hallmarks of this neighborhood. The neighborhood is diverse and accepting of all. You will find artistic venues and experimental theater, together with a broad spectrum of bars, including speakeasies, and restaurants featuring myriad cuisines.

The West Village is primarily residential, conspicuously lacking the high-rise office buildings that characterize other neighborhoods. This lends an air of quiet sophistication during the day. At night, the area becomes more lively, as residents frequent their favorite restaurants, theaters, cafes, and gastropubs. Housing consists of brownstones dating back to the 18th century, low-rise walk-ups, townhouses, artists lofts, and condos in renovated buildings. Newer high-rise residential buildings are cropping up along the Hudson River. Always popular with celebrities and artistic types, the West Village is now attracting families and young professionals in the tech and financial fields.
